Board hears county overdose numbers: 26 confirmed deaths in 2025; 2026 cases pending

Butler County Drug & Alcohol Advisory Board · February 17, 2026

Director Donna Jenereski reported Butler County had 26 confirmed overdose deaths in 2025 with five pending; for 2026 there are two confirmed deaths and seven pending cases—figures reported for situational awareness and planning.

At the Feb. 17 advisory board meeting, Director Donna Jenereski provided Butler County’s overdose update: 26 confirmed overdose deaths in 2025 with five cases still pending final determination. For 2026, the county had two confirmed overdose deaths at the time of the report, with seven pending cases.

Jenereski noted the 2026 figures are comparable to the same point last year (two confirmed and seven pending). The board received the numbers as part of routine monitoring and no new policy action was recorded in the minutes.
